No retail installment contract or retail charge account or separate instruments executed in connection therewith shall contain any provisions whereby the retail buyer waives any right of action or defense against the retail seller, sales finance company, holder or other person acting on his or her behalf for any illegal act committed in the collection of the payments under the contract or account or in the repossession of the goods, the subject of the retail installment contract or retail charge account and any such provision shall be void and unenforceable.

L.1960, c. 40, p. 155, s. 36. Amended by L.1971, c. 409, s. 7.
